Kerry Road is in Montgomery and in Powys district. SY15 6PD is located in the Forden and Montgomery elect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Montgomeryshire.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Kerry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Kerry Road was 40.4 per 1,000 residents, which is 75.4% higher than the Berriew and Castle Caereinion average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Kerry Road has the 18th highest crime rate of 53 local areas in Berriew and Castle Caereinion and the 179th lowest crime rate of 434 local areas in Powys .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 25.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have remained broadly unchanged year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-46.3%.
